Orc heroes get an extra food item ("to compensate for generally
inferior equipment") and it could randomly be lembas wafers (or
cram rations), and Ranger heroes always started with cram rations
even when they're orcs. Fixing the latter was simple, but the
normal race-based substitutions weren't applied to randomly
generated items, so the fix for the former required a bit of code
reorganization in ini_inv().
Elf heroes already get lembas instead of cram; do the reverse for
dwarves (although I don't think this case can happen--no role gets
lembas wafers and only orcs and always-human tourists get random
food); give orc heroes tripe instead of either lembas or cram.

> 2. perm_invent window does not get updated when charging a wand (or
> other chargeable item presumably), with a scroll of charging.
Most scrolls rely on useup() -> update_inventory(), but charging uses up
the scroll early so that it will be gone from inventory when choosing an
item to charge. It needed an explicit update_inventory() after charging.
> 3. update_inventory(), is called from setworn(), which is called from
> dorestore(), when loading a save. Segfaults have been observed in
> variants based on this code (though not yet in vanilla 3.6.1), so it's
> possible this may be unsafe. The update_inventory() call in setworn()
> could be protected with "if (!restoring) ..."
tty doesn't support perm_invent, so this might be a win32 issue.
I've made the suggested change, but a better fix would be to turn off
perm_invent as soon as options processing (new game) or options restore
(old game unless/until #1 gets changed) has finished setting things up,
then turn it back on at the end of moveloop()'s prolog when play is
about to start.

There was a prior report about this but I can't find it; maybe it
didn't go through the web contact form. Anyway, status_hilite
threshold numeric values wouldn't accept a minus sign before the
digits, preventing negative AC values from being tracked.
The 'O' menu's 'list' for MSGTYPE settings showed truncated versions
of really long message strings but didn't show anything except the
hide/stop/norep setting for ordinary length ones. 3.6.0 showed the
latter correctly but suffered buffer overflow for the former; the
fix for that had a typo/thinko in it.

Noticed while testing the fix for the recently reported clairvoyance
bug. I saw a '1' move onto an 'I', then when it moved again the 'I'
reappeared. The remembered unseen monster couldn't be there anymore
if the warned-of monster was able to walk through that spot, so
remove any 'I' when showing a warning (digit) to stop remembering an
unseen monster at the warning spot.
Nobody has ever reported this so fixing it isn't urgent, but fixing
it is trivial so I'm doing it in now (without the clairvoyance fix).

Instead of replacing the check for DRAWBRIDGE_UP with one for
DRAWBRIDGE_DOWN, the correct fix is to check for both because
replacing either one with water breaks the two-square dbridge.

> When moving from a pit into an adjacent pit, you "fall into" the pit and take
> damage. This happens even when you are walking back and forth between two pits,
> repeatedly, where you should have no way to fall.
>
> The intent seems to be that you can move into the adjacent pit without having
> to climb out of the first one, and this works properly - the only problem is
> that the pit gets triggered when you ought to have no distance to fall.
This is really just stumbling over uncleared clutter, not a pit fall.
There was already a way to clear the clutter between adjacent pits.
